    Setting timers for outdoor lighting
    Can someone explain how to set an outdoor timer for lighting to come on automatically by timer between 7-11 pm only. The timers are wheel type timers (non-digital). When I lift the timers I can set them to the a specific time, but when pushing the timer back in place and setting the time of day both inside and outside wheels spin together.

    There is a small on/off switch at the top of the timer box, but when placing it in the on position, the lights stay on all the time. In off position, they are off all the time.

    What model timer is it?

    There are a few variations. Some have red and black tabs that you slide to your desired on/off times. Red usually is for on.

    Other styles have metal tabs with a setscrew. You move these to the desired times and tighten the screw to lock it in place.
